use jsonEncode() and jsonDecode() from ‘dart:convert’ to serialize JSON data . create model classes with fromJson() and toJson() for all domain-specific JSON objects in your app. add explicit casts, validation, and null checks inside fromJson() to make the parsing code more robust.

Read moreDoes dart support JSON?
Dart has built in support for parsing json . Given a String you can use the dart:convert library and convert the Json (if valid json) to a Map with string keys and dynamic objects.
